Output f8661216650bfc847be80ddfaef2946e66cab9358b6c49e93821feccb14c1421:125

value
42451
script pubkey
OP_0 OP_PUSHBYTES_20 2ebaa6f995f5e4941384b4eec3b00237cfba6194
address
bc1q96a2d7v47hjfgyuyknhv8vqzxl8m5cv52rkuq7
transaction
f8661216650bfc847be80ddfaef2946e66cab9358b6c49e93821feccb14c1421